Factors Affecting Car Insurance Rates

Various key factors play a significant role in determining the rates of car insurance for individuals in Washington. Two important factors that greatly impact insurance premiums are the individual’s driving record and credit score.

A person’s driving record is a primary consideration for insurance companies when calculating the cost of coverage. A clean driving record with no accidents or traffic violations signals to insurers that the individual is a low-risk driver, likely to cause fewer claims in the future. On the other hand, a history of accidents, speeding tickets, or DUI convictions can lead to higher insurance rates as it suggests a higher likelihood of filing claims.

Credit scores also play a role in determining car insurance rates in Washington. Insurance companies often use credit information to predict the likelihood of a policyholder filing a claim. Studies have shown a correlation between credit history and the probability of insurance losses. Individuals with lower credit scores may be charged higher premiums as they are perceived to pose a higher risk to insurers.

Comparison Shopping for the Best Rates

When seeking the most cost-effective car insurance rates in Washington, engaging in comparison shopping across different insurance providers is a strategic approach to finding the best coverage options tailored to individual needs and circumstances. Rate comparison plays an important role in determining the affordability of car insurance. By obtaining quotes from multiple insurers, individuals can evaluate the premiums, deductibles, and coverage limits offered by each company. This allows for an informed decision based on a detailed understanding of the available options.

In Washington, car insurance providers offer a variety of coverage options to meet the diverse needs of drivers. When comparing rates, it is essential to take into account not only the cost but also the extent of coverage provided. Factors such as liability coverage, comprehensive and collision coverage, uninsured motorist protection, and personal injury protection should be evaluated to make sure adequate protection in the event of an accident.

Moreover, it is advisable to assess any additional benefits or perks offered by insurance companies, such as roadside assistance, rental car reimbursement, or accident forgiveness programs. These extras can add value to a policy and may influence the overall cost-effectiveness of the coverage. By carefully examining both the rates and coverage options available from different insurers, individuals can secure the most affordable car insurance that meets their specific requirements.

Taking Advantage of Discounts and Savings

To maximize cost savings on car insurance premiums, it is advantageous for policyholders to explore and take advantage of available discounts and savings opportunities offered by insurance providers. By understanding discount eligibility criteria and actively seeking out savings opportunities, drivers in Washington can greatly reduce their insurance expenses. Here are some common discounts and savings options that policyholders should consider:

Discount Type Description Eligibility
Multi-Policy Discount Bundling car insurance with another policy Insuring multiple vehicles or combining policies
Safe Driver Discount Reward for a history of safe driving No accidents or traffic violations
Good Student Discount Discount for students with good academic performance Maintaining a certain GPA and being a full-time student

These discounts can vary between insurance providers, so it is essential for drivers to inquire about all potential savings opportunities when shopping for car insurance. Additionally, some insurers offer discounts for factors such as vehicle safety features, low mileage, or participation in usage-based insurance programs. By actively seeking out and taking advantage of these discounts and savings opportunities, drivers in Washington can secure more affordable car insurance premiums while still maintaining adequate coverage.

Tips for Lowering Your Premium

Exploring practical strategies for reducing your car insurance premium can help Washington drivers secure more affordable coverage without compromising on protection levels. One effective way to lower your premium is by adjusting your driving habits. Maintaining a clean driving record free of accidents and traffic violations can have a major impact on the cost of your insurance. Safe driving behaviors not only keep you and others on the road safe but also demonstrate to insurance providers that you are a responsible and low-risk driver, leading to potential discounts on your premium.

Another factor to contemplate when aiming to lower your car insurance premium is the type of vehicle you drive. Insurance companies often take into account the make and model of your car when determining your premium. Generally, cars with high safety ratings and lower theft rates can result in lower insurance costs. Additionally, vehicles equipped with safety features such as anti-theft devices, airbags, and backup cameras may also qualify for discounts.

Understanding Washington State Insurance Requirements

To operate a vehicle legally in Washington State, drivers must adhere to specific insurance requirements outlined by state law. Washington state minimums mandate that drivers must have liability coverage with at least 25/50/10 limits. This means coverage up to $25,000 for injuries per person, $50,000 for injuries per accident, and $10,000 for property damage. Personal Injury Protection (PIP) of at least $10,000 is also mandatory, covering medical expenses and lost wages regardless of fault.

In addition to the basic requirements, Washington State offers optional coverage options for drivers to enhance their protection. Collision coverage helps pay for repairs to your vehicle after an accident, while inclusive coverage protects against non-collision incidents like theft or natural disasters.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ist coverage is also available to cover costs if you are in an accident with a driver who lacks sufficient insurance.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Does My Credit Score Affect My Car Insurance Rates in Washington?

Credit scores can greatly impact car insurance rates in Washington. Alongside age and driving history, they are key factors affecting premiums. Insurers may view lower credit scores as higher risk, leading to increased rates.

Can I Insure a Car That Is Registered in Someone Else’s Name in Washington?

When insuring a car registered in another’s name in Washington, it’s possible. Different insurance policies exist for this scenario. Confirm all parties involved understand the arrangement to align coverage with ownership and responsibilities accurately.

Do Car Insurance Rates Vary by City in Washington?

Yes, car insurance rates vary by city in Washington. Factors such as population density, traffic patterns, and accident rates influence insurance costs. Cities with higher populations and traffic congestion tend to have increased insurance rates due to heightened risks.

Are There Any Special Discounts Available for Military Members and Veterans in Washington?

Military members and veterans in Washington may be eligible for special discounts on car insurance. Insurance providers often offer reduced rates and benefits tailored to those who have served. It is advisable to inquire about these offerings.

Is It Possible to Insure a Car That Is Used for Ridesharing Services Like Uber or Lyft in Washington?

When insuring a car used for ridesharing services like Uber or Lyft in Washington, it’s important to obtain ridesharing coverage. Washington regulations require specific insurance policies for such vehicles to guarantee adequate protection for drivers and passengers.
